Planning an international MICE experience involves much more than selecting a destination and booking a venue. From corporate meetings and conferences to incentive trips and exhibitions, every detail needs to work together seamlessly.
With teams travelling across borders, multiple suppliers involved, and different cultural and logistical considerations, businesses need a structured approach to MICE planning. This is where an experienced destination management company can make a significant difference.
1. Start With Clear Objectives
Before choosing a destination, define what the event needs to achieve. Is it a leadership meeting, client engagement, incentive programme, product launch, or team-building experience?
Clear objectives help determine the right destination, format, budget, activities, and overall experience.
2. Choose the Right Destination
The destination can influence the success of the entire MICE programme. Consider accessibility, flight connectivity, accommodation, venues, local experiences, seasonality, and overall budget.

3. Select the Right Venue & Accommodation
The venue should match the event’s purpose while offering convenience and flexibility. Consider meeting facilities, accommodation, technology, dining options, accessibility, and proximity to key attractions.

4. Plan Transportation & Logistics
International MICE programmes involve multiple moving parts—airport transfers, local transportation, group movements, accommodation, event venues, and activities.
Professional corporate travel management helps coordinate these elements, reducing delays and ensuring participants know where they need to be throughout the programme.
5. Create Meaningful Experiences
A successful MICE experience should go beyond meetings. Add local experiences, cultural activities, team-building opportunities, fine dining, entertainment, or unique excursions that allow participants to experience the destination.
These experiences can make corporate events more memorable while strengthening relationships and engagement.

7. Have a Backup Plan
International events can be affected by weather, transport disruptions, venue issues, or unexpected changes. A seamless MICE programme requires contingency planning.
Having alternative transportation, backup activities, flexible schedules, and on-ground support ensures the programme can continue with minimal disruption.

How far in advance should international MICE planning begin?
International corporate travel and MICE planning should begin 6 to 12 months in advance. Early planning secures top-tier venues, optimizes group transportation rates, and provides sufficient lead time for visa processing and local logistics coordination.
